Background
Though Radiohead had been critically praised for albums like The Bends, it was not until 1997's OK Computer that they gained national fame.Rolling Stone: Radiohead Biography Their follow-up album, Kid A, debuted at #1 on the Billboard 200, and subsequent albums have since peaked high on the chart.
The band's music is known for its minimalistic use of vocals, guitars and electronics with lyrics that depict "twisted tales of angst and alienation."Allmusic: Radiohead Biography
The Band
- Thom Yorke: Lead vocals and gutar
- Ed O'Brien: Guitar, backup vocals
- Johnny Greenwood: Lead guitar, various instruments
- Colin Greenwood: Bass
- Phil Selway: Drums
